Summary
Ernesto Corral is a cybersecurity leader and CEO with 13 years of hands-on experience in incident response, malware analysis, digital forensics and penetration testing across financial, governmental and EU institutions. He combines technical depth—reverse engineering, DFIR and threat hunting—with client-facing skills, having built IR plans, trained teams and briefed executives at organizations like the Single Resolution Board and the Council of the EU. As a former threat analyst and co‑founder/CTO, he has built labs and tooling for malware and intelligence work and continues to develop research projects (notably the Gummer malware-hunting tool). Based in Brussels, he blends practical engineering roots with strategic security consulting and regularly contributes insights through talks, training and blog posts.
